I recently bought a 96 Disco and I noticed that when the lights are on the main front blinker/parking lights do not come on like they do on most cars...also the little tiny yellow lights on the sides stay off as well. Are they supposed to be on or not? THANKS!!

Normal! I have a 98 Disco and the yellow lights you are referring to do not come on when you turn on the headlight switch; but they do blink (that and the side yellow lights) when you turn on the turn signal.

I like Rian's idea better. Before you go tearing into the light-housings check your manual. My yellow front, rear and side lights only come on when using the directional signals or emergency flashers. They do not come on with the parking/dash lights (my dimmed headlights and red rears do).
Different models in different parts of the world my friends. DiscoWeb has an international following and each individual Disco was designed to meet the road requirements of where it was destined to be driven. If in doubt, check the operators manual!
